## Changed defaults

Starting with LanternGate 4.2, the flag rollout framework ships with safer defaults for new teams. Gradual rollouts now begin at 1% instead of 10%, sticky bucketing is enabled out of the box, and stale flags are flagged for cleanup after 90 days rather than never. If you onboarded before this release, your existing projects keep their old settings unless you opt in. For reference, a freshly initialized project now starts with the following configuration.

deployment values, yafop-tahof:
HOLIX_HOST=holix.zemvarsys.internal
HOLIX_PORT=3306

Careful here: report exports in Ledgerbird must render timestamps in the workspace's configured zone, not the server's. We store UTC everywhere and convert only at the formatting layer — converting earlier double-applies offsets around DST transitions, which caused last quarter's bug. The conversion window, clamp bounds, and cache TTL all live in one place so reviewers can audit them. Those constants are listed below.

tuning constants:
QUOTAS = {
    "druwyn": 5,
    "holix": 5,
    "zorath": 5,
    "holwyn": 10,
}

## Migration step 4: Watchdog cut-over

Applies to Perchpoint kiosk fleet. Old watchdog polled the UI thread; new one uses heartbeat files. Steps: stop the legacy watchdog service, install the v3 agent, remove the old polling entry from the boot script, reboot once. Do not run both agents — they fight over restart locks and the kiosk loops. Verify heartbeat file updates every interval before signing off a unit. The v3 agent ships with the settings below.

settings of yajog-bageg:
[drudor]
host = drudor.paliqworks.internal
user = drudor_svc
database = drudor_prod

Subject: Sealed exam papers — Wednesday delivery

Hi dispatch,

The Caldmere Institute exam packets leave our print room Wednesday at 07:30, bound for the Rowanfield testing centre. Packets are shrink-wrapped and banded; the receiving site should check that all bands are unbroken before signing. Count is twelve packets, one carton. Please hold the carton in the secure room until the invigilation team collects it. On arrival, the courier is to be given the following confidential hand-over instruction.

handover note for yagef-bagep: the drudor pelius courier leaves the kasdor zorvan norir ledger at gate 8016 under passcode 755406